Fyi
I'm 99% sure the HID light outputs are the same.. (not sure on the pattern difference on RHD)
Besides the plastic bumper bracket, everything else bolts up and plugs in exactly the same.
The 2011-2012 IS-F Headlight Housings share the same part numbers with the 2011-2012 IS-C
